Biography

Cornelius d'Arcy Brain was born on 11 May 1892 in Souris, Manitoba, Canada , son of Cornelius John Brain (~1863–~1928) and Florence Ada Rynd Thompson (1864–1928).[1][2]

He moved to England with his parent when he was about seven years old,[3] and on 17 December 1913 he married Eunice Thompson, daughter of Joseph Evans Thompson and Eunice Dyke, at Ruardean, Gloucestershire, England.[4][5][6]

They soon moved to New Zealand, where they raised their family:[7]

  1. Cornelius John d'Arcy Brain (1915-1991) twin
  2. Joseph Thompson d'Arcy Brain (1915-1976) twin
  3. Florence Eunice d’Arcy (Brain) Anderson (1916-2002)
  4. William Walter d'Arcy Brain (1918-1944)
  5. Kate Elizabeth d'Arcy (Brain) Roulston (1923-2005)
  6. Thomas Edward d'Arcy Brain (1920s-2010s)

Neil worked in the milk industry. He owned an unsuccessful milk run for a number of years before becoming factory manager for a large ice cream company in Christchurch.[8]

Neil died on 28 July 1965 in Oamaru, Otago, New Zealand, aged about 73. He was buried in Ōamaru Lawn Cemetery, Ōamaru, Waitaki District, Otago.[1]
